+ B3 Patchpoint and Check opcodes should be able to specify WarmAny, ColdAny, and LateColdAny
+ https://bugs.webkit.org/show_bug.cgi?id=151335
+
+ Reviewed by Geoffrey Garen.
+
+ This removes ValueRep::Any and replaces it with ValueRep::WarmAny, ValueRep::ColdAny, and
+ ValueRep::LateColdAny. I think that conceptually the most obvious users of patchpoints are inline
+ caches, which would use WarmAny for their non-OSR inputs. For this reason, I make WarmAny the
+ default.
+
+ However, the StackmapValue optimization that provides a default ValueRep for any that are missing
+ was meant for OSR. So, this optimization now uses ColdAny.
+
+ This patch wires this change through the whole compiler and adds some tests.

class ValueRep {
public:
enum Kind {
- // As an input representation, this means that B3 can pick any representation. It also currently
- // implies that the use is cold: the register allocator doesn't count it. As an output
+ // As an input representation, this means that B3 can pick any representation. As an output
// representation, this means that we don't know. This will only arise as an output
// representation for the active arguments of Check/CheckAdd/CheckSub/CheckMul.
- Any,
+ WarmAny,
+ // Same as WarmAny, but implies that the use is cold. A cold use is not counted as a use for
+ // computing the priority of the used temporary.
+ ColdAny,
+
+ // Same as ColdAny, but also implies that the use occurs after all other effects of the stackmap
+ // value.
+ LateColdAny,
+
// As an input representation, this means that B3 should pick some register. It could be a
// register that this claims to clobber!
SomeRegister,
